What is a CD61 (Megakaryocytic Cell Marker) Test in Visit Clinic?

The CD61 test detects a protein called CD61 that sits on platelets and megakaryocytes. These cells make and carry platelets, which help blood clot. Measuring CD61 helps identify cells of the platelet lineage in bone marrow or tissue samples. Doctors use it to find abnormal platelet production, to classify certain blood cancers, and to check for megakaryocytic involvement in marrow diseases. It helps diagnose conditions like thrombocytopenia, acute megakaryoblastic leukemia, and myeloproliferative disorders. Results guide treatment choices and help monitor response to therapy. The test is usually done as part of tissue staining or flow cytometry when blood counts or symptoms suggest a platelet problem.

Why Take a CD61 (Megakaryocytic Cell Marker) Test in Visit Clinic?

CD61 (Megakaryocytic Cell Marker) is often included in immunohistochemistry or flow cytometry panels for bone marrow and blood evaluation. Doctors may order it for unexplained low platelets, easy bruising, bleeding, or abnormal blood counts. It helps diagnose or monitor platelet production problems, megakaryocytic leukemias, and myeloproliferative disorders. Abnormal results can come from marrow diseases, cancers, infections, or medication effects. A family history of platelet disorders may make this test more relevant.

What is CD61 a marker for in Visit Clinic?plus

CD61 is the designation for integrin β3, a cell-surface marker mainly expressed on platelets and megakaryocytes. It forms part of the GPIIb/IIIa (αIIbβ3) complex involved in platelet adhesion and aggregation. CD61 is also detected on some endothelial cells and in megakaryocytic-lineage leukemias, so it’s used diagnostically to identify platelet/megakaryocyte differentiation.

What is the CD marker for megakaryocytes in Visit Clinic?plus

Megakaryocytes characteristically express CD41 (integrin αIIb), CD61 (integrin β3) and CD42 (glycoprotein Ib complex). CD41/CD61 form the αIIbβ3 integrin commonly used to identify megakaryocytic lineage and platelets, while CD42 is associated with more mature megakaryocytes. These markers are routinely applied in flow cytometry and immunohistochemistry to study megakaryocyte development.

What is another name for CD61 in Visit Clinic?plus

CD61 is another name for integrin beta-3 (ITGB3), also called platelet glycoprotein IIIa (GPIIIa). It pairs with integrin alpha-IIb (CD41/GPIIb) to form the platelet fibrinogen receptor complex (GPIIb/IIIa), which mediates platelet aggregation and adhesion. Mutations or antibodies to CD61 can affect clotting and contribute to thrombotic or bleeding disorders.

What is CD41 CD61 in Visit Clinic?plus

CD41 and CD61 are surface proteins that pair to form the integrin αIIbβ3 receptor on platelets and megakaryocytes. This receptor binds fibrinogen and von Willebrand factor to enable platelet aggregation and clot formation. Flow cytometry measures CD41/CD61 to assess platelet count and function; inherited absence or dysfunction causes bleeding disorders such as Glanzmann thrombasthenia and can inform thrombotic risk.

What is the marker for leukemia and lymphoma in Visit Clinic?plus

Lactate dehydrogenase (LDH) is the most commonly used blood marker for many leukemias and lymphomas; elevated LDH often reflects high tumor burden and poorer prognosis. Diagnosis and subtyping depend on additional markers—cytogenetic abnormalities (e.g., BCR‑ABL in CML) and immunophenotyping (CD markers such as CD19, CD20, CD34)—so LDH is a general activity/prognostic marker, not disease-specific.

What is the name of the CD61 gene in Visit Clinic?plus

CD61 is the cluster-of-differentiation designation for the ITGB3 gene, which encodes integrin beta-3 (also called glycoprotein IIIa). This protein pairs with integrin alpha subunits (notably αIIb) to form the fibrinogen receptor αIIbβ3 on platelets, crucial for platelet adhesion, aggregation and coagulation; mutations can alter bleeding and thrombosis risk.
